Schalke 04 have reportedly put a £12m asking price on Assan Ouedraogo amid growing rumours that Liverpool are interested.

According to journalist Florian Plettenberg, the German giants want as much as €15m (£12m) for their 17-year-old wonderkid, with AC Milan and Bayern Munich also interested in Ouedraogo.

Praised by Football Talent Scout as an ‘intelligent’ player, Ouedraogo is making quite a name for himself with Schalke in the German second-tier.

So much so that the teenager is now one of the most wanted players in all of Germany, with Liverpool now in the chase to sign Ouedraogo next year.

As per Plettenberg’s reporting, though, the teenager wants to play regular football, something Jurgen Klopp’s side will struggle to offer, especially if they qualify for the UEFA Champions League.

And as a result, the likes of Bayern or Milan could be more appealing options for Ouedraogo, with Liverpool already at a disadvantage for the 17-year-old prospect.
